Medicare Advantage 2026 Spotlight: A First Look at Plan Premiums and Benefits

Medicare Advantage plans, which enrolled more than 34 million Medicare beneficiaries or 54% of the eligible Medicare population in 2025, typically offer extra benefits, such as dental, vision, and hearing, often for no additional premium, as well as lower cost sharing compared to traditional Medicare without supplemental insurance. New Release: Tor Browser 15.0.3

Tor Browser 15.0.3 is now available from the Tor Browser download page and also from our distribution directory. This version includes important security updates to Firefox.
